Abstract
Segregation energies of isolated Pd in PdAu(1 1 1) alloy are investigated by DFT calculations as a function of the oxygen coverage. Segregation of Pd is found to be oxygen-coverage dependent. While for ‘clean’ PdAu(1 1 1), Pd prefers to be in the bulk, in the presence of more than 1/3 ML of oxygen, Pd meanly segregates to the surface. The analysis of Pd d -band provides evidence of strong Pd–O affinity. The understanding of such behaviour is of interest in the field of heterogeneous catalysis because of the lack of information about the surface ordering in bimetallic alloys in the presence of reactive gas.
